
November Web Site Traffic Is Highest Ever
December 1, 2004 - ECHL (ECHL) News Release
PRINCETON, N.J. - The ECHL announced that its official web site at echl.com had its highest monthly page impressions (1,911,425) and average daily impressions (63,714) in November. The previous high for page impressions (1,502,580) and average page impressions (48,470) were set in March. The site surpassed its 2003 totals in the first eight months of 2004.
The total page impressions are up 208 percent from November 2003 and up 27 percent from October. The average page impressions are up 208 percent from November 2003 and up 31 percent from October.
Comparing the first 11 months of 2004 with the same time period in 2003, the web site has had 11,022,796 page impressions, up 80 percent; 920,919 unique visitors, an increase of 68 percent; and 2,176,066 user sessions, up 75 percent.
In its second season, the ECHL.com Network has links to teams and league partners and provides fans with information on league programs and contests, including "Win A Trip To The 2005 Coors Light ECHL All-Star Game".
ECHL.com is a member of the NHL.com Network for the fourth year in a row. NHL.com is a 46-site network that includes the official National Hockey League web site as well as NHL team sites and NHL partners, including the top two developmental leagues with the ECHL and the American Hockey League.
The ECHL web site has been hosted the past three years by GKG Sports Network located in College Station, Texas.
